Inhibition of bone resorption in vitro by a cartilage-derived anticollagenase factor.

J E Horton, F H Wezeman, K E Kuettner.   

Abstract

A cartilage-derived factor containing a specific collagenous inhibitor was found to block reversibly parathyroid hormone-stimulated 45Ca release from fetal rat bone in vitro. Morphologic and quantitative histometric examination revealed that this factor modulates osteoclastic activities.
